Transaction 8783ef9867f24514c98c1cedd66e72b6643e48c3423eb908512b9b1e73ccae00

175 Input
2 Outputs
  • 8783ef9867f24514c98c1cedd66e72b6643e48c3423eb908512b9b1e73ccae00:0
  • value  2202
    address  32iWLSCcRbRffwyfe2mLDGUFaYre5f8wGm
  • 8783ef9867f24514c98c1cedd66e72b6643e48c3423eb908512b9b1e73ccae00:1
  • value  100000000
    address  3NrTf9Q2amgZLkESJzvCF5enRdjwQNwFvb